There is a trick to getting the speaker grills off. I removed the door skins to get to the back of the speaker grills. The grills have 4 little snaps on the back, whats messed up is 2 of the snaps are normal and 2 are melted the door skin. They must melt 2 of the plastic snap to the plastic on the door skin at the factory. Be very careful the plastic is thin and you can ruin the speaker grill. I just used a small blade to cut the melted 2 snaps and made a clean cut. After I painted the grills I just snapped them in to the door skins and they are tight with just 2 snaps. If you want to you can use a glue gun to seal the other 2 snaps, I didn't think it needed it.
